Rep. Pat Ryan, currently serving in the U.S. Congress representing New York’s 18th district, has taken to social media to express his stance on various issues affecting his constituents. Through a series of tweets, Ryan outlines his commitment to fighting against what he describes as chaos and closures while providing direct assistance to families in need.

On March 11, 2025, Rep. Pat Ryan declared his opposition to ongoing disruptions and harmful policies by stating “I refuse to vote for a continuation of the chaos, closures, and harm.” He emphasized his dedication with the statement “I will always fight for YOU.”

The following day, March 12, 2025, Ryan addressed concerns about federal program cuts impacting Social Security, Medicaid, and Medicare. He announced efforts to assist affected individuals through the C.A.R.E.S Van initiative. In his words: “Amidst the cuts, closures and uncertainty with federal programs like Social Security, Medicaid and Medicare…” The initiative aims to provide one-on-one assistance throughout New York’s 18th district.

Continuing on March 12, Rep. Ryan invited constituents to view more details about the C.A.R.E.S Van schedule by directing them via a tweet: “Check out the full schedule…”
